Sanyo Katana White bows on SprintBy Jennifer Hooker, 8 February 2007
GALLERY
Sanyo Katana White
Enlarge
Sanyo Katana White
Enlarge
The polar white flavor of the Katana, previously a Radio Shack exclusive, arrives in Sprint's lineup in time for winter. Best features: a VGA camera and Bluetooth.

Attention, fashion-conscious chatters: if you've been pining for the white version of the Sanyo Katana (read our full review) but didn't want to venture out to your local Radio Shack, you're in luck. The polar white version of the sleek clamshell (which is also available in blue sapphire, mystic black, and cherry blossom pink) just dropped on Sprint's Web site.

The Katana White maintains the same basic calling features as its predecessor, including a VGA camera, Bluetooth, a speakerphone and voice tagging. The clamshell is also 1xRTT-only, so you won't have access to the Sprint Power Vision network. Fortunately, the White Katana won't cost you a dime extra compared to the original, and retails for $50 on Sprint with a two-year service agreement.

Specifications

  • CDMA/1xRTT
  • VGA camera
  • Bluetooth
  • Voice tagging
  • Speakerphone
  • Measures: 3.9 by 2 by 0.6 inches
  • Weight: 3.4 ounces

    Price & availability

    The Sanyo Katana White is available immediately from Sprint and retails for $280 or $50 with a two-year service contract.
